Biological monitoring for the exposure to alkylating agents
ABF Analytisch-Biologisches Forschungslabor GmbH, Munich, Germany
Tobacco smoke has been shown to be capable of alkylating nucleophilic centers in biological macromolecules (DNA, RNA, proteins, glutathione) and thus giving rise to various forms of cell damage. The potential precursors in smoke are volatile and...
